What Makes Up Picture Impact Windows?

Picture impact windows are large, fixed-pane windows built with laminated safety glass that stays intact even when impacted by storm projectiles. The primary material consists of two tempered glass panes adhered around a durable PVB membrane — comparable to automotive windshields. When pressure occurs, the glass might break but holds together.

The surrounding structure on picture impact windows are a key part of the equation. Heavy-duty aluminum or composite framing are fastened securely into the building envelope with code-specified fasteners that distribute pressure forces directly into the wall assembly. This integrated approach is what makes it possible for them to earn their Miami-Dade NOA ratings.

Because picture impact windows are stationary panels that cannot be opened, they are available in much larger sizes than windows with moving parts. This suits them well for living areas where sweeping views are the main objective.

Top Advantages Picture Impact Windows

  • Category 5 Wind Resistance: Picture impact windows are certified and approved to resist wind speeds well above what most Florida hurricanes generate, keeping your property protected throughout the storm season.
  • Wide-Open Visual Connections to the Outdoors: Without movable components, picture impact windows maximize glass area, creating a virtually uninterrupted view of surrounding landscapes.
  • Acoustic Comfort: The laminated glass construction in picture impact windows significantly reduces exterior noise penetration — a major benefit for homes adjacent to commercial areas.
  • Lower Utility Bills: Low-E coatings applied to picture impact windows block solar heat gain while preserving natural illumination, which contributes to cooling costs lower in the Florida heat.
  • Stronger Resale Appeal: Installing picture impact windows contributes measurable equity to your real estate investment, as buyers are drawn to homes that are fully code-compliant.
  • Insurance Premium Savings: Florida homeowners who install picture impact windows often receive significant reductions in homeowners policy costs through most Florida insurers.
  • Safeguarding Indoor Décor: The laminated interlayer in picture impact windows filters out nearly 99% of ultraviolet rays, protecting your valuable home décor.
  • Freedom from Pre-Storm Boarding: Because picture impact windows offer year-round impact defense, you can stop worrying about having to install panels before an approaching storm.

The Picture Impact Windows Upgrade Process in Detail

  1. On-Site Assessment and Window Sizing — A trained specialist from our crew schedules an on-site appointment to assess the installation location with professional-grade instruments. We discuss your goals — view lines, glass tints, frame colors — so your picture impact windows are customized before production begins.
  2. Custom Manufacturing and Order Processing — Your picture impact windows are built to specification by rated manufacturing partners using your precise dimensions. This stage generally runs several weeks depending on order volume, during which permit applications are filed on your behalf through the municipality.
  3. Pre-Installation Setup — On installation day, our installers lay down drop cloths and protective materials before extracting old window units. Existing rough opening components are inspected for any problems that need addressing before new units go in.
  4. Anchoring the New Window Assembly — Each picture impact window panel is precisely placed within the wall assembly and aligned using precision levels. Engineered screws are driven through the frame at rated intervals to satisfy the certified structural performance. Proper anchoring is non-negotiable — it's what determines whether the window performs as rated.
  5. Sealing, Flashing, and Weatherproofing — High-performance caulk are used at every seam to establish a weathertight seal. Self-adhering weather barriers are integrated following engineered details to protect the wall assembly from the opening.
  6. Permit Closeout and Code Verification — A municipal code official visits to review the completed work meets current impact window standards. Our project managers arrange the appointment and are available to address any questions during the review.

Picture Impact Windows Common Questions Answered

How wide can picture impact windows be made?

Picture impact windows can be custom-fabricated in much bigger configurations than operable windows. Subject to engineering requirements, individual panes can reach heights exceeding six feet for a bold design statement. Our team will confirm maximum size limits during your site assessment.

Are picture impact windows rated for Category 5 hurricanes?

Yes. With the right product and proper installation, picture impact windows hold product approvals for high-velocity hurricane zone compliance — the highest testing standard in Florida. This certifies performance under the conditions associated with the strongest hurricanes.

Do picture impact windows help with sound reduction?

Significantly. The laminated glass construction in picture impact windows interrupts sound transmission that conventional glazing simply can't replicate. Most residents report a noticeable reduction in ambient noise after installation is complete.

How long does a standard picture impact windows installation take?

For the typical residential project, picture impact windows can be installed in one to two days depending on total project scope. Projects involving many oversized units may take a bit more time. The lead time for manufacturing is usually several weeks before your project start date.

Will picture impact windows affect my wind insurance costs?

In the majority of situations, yes — positively. Florida insurers frequently offer storm hardening incentives to homeowners who install code-compliant impact glazing. After your picture impact windows are inspected and approved, we recommend scheduling a wind mitigation inspection to unlock potential premium reductions.
